Full Spectrum CBD and the Entourage Effect

Full spectrum CBD oil is a blend of cannabinoid, terpene, and flavonoids that work together like an orchestra for overall health. However, this oil does contain some trace amounts of THC and could result in positive results on drug tests for those who undergo regular drug testing at the workplace.

Benefits

Full-spectrum CBD offers a wide range of benefits thanks to the entourage effect. This is how the various cannabinoids and terpenes interact instead of competing against one another, to bring you multiple effects that are far more powerful than any single cannabinoid its own.

CBN (cannabinol), on the other hand, can enhance the euphoric effects of THC and lessen the negative adverse effects of THC, such as anxiety dizziness, anxiety dry mouth, and dizziness. This is why most people prefer a full spectrum product over the traditional CBD isolate.

The use of full spectrum oils can aid in the treatment of a variety ailments, including pain, sleep disorders nausea and vomiting, depression, anxiety and epileptic seizures. However, you may need to experiment with a few different products before you find the one that is right for you.

If you are a beginner or just starting out, you may want to start out with a lower potency of CBD that is full spectrum. This is due to the fact that most full-spectrum products only contain a small amount of THC usually less than 0.3 percent. This amount of THC, dependent on the brand you are using and how much you use it, could be sufficient to cause impairment or test positive for drugs.

Tinctures and capsules are two of the most well-known methods to get the full spectrum of CBD. Both are easily absorbed by the body after swallowing, but tinctures are more efficient at dispersing the oil throughout your digestive system. For fast absorption, hold the tincture with your tongue for 30 to 60 minutes prior to taking it in.

Interactions

Many people take prescription or OTC medicines. Cannabinoids, like CBD may interact with these medications. This is why it's important to consult with a physician before taking any supplements, not just CBD with a full spectrum. CBD can interfere with the hepatic enzyme CYP2D6 which influences the metabolism of various antidepressants and SSRIs. It can increase serum concentrations of selective serotonin-reuptake inhibitors like sertraline, and decrease the effectiveness of monoamine-oxidase (MAOIs), such as the phenelzine-based tranylcypromine. It may also enhance the effects of anticonvulsant drugs such as valproate and lamotrigine.
